* A Lexeme can have multiple lemmas, one per language code. (Note: The exact set of language codes is currently unspecified, but is most probably going to be limited to a configured set of a few hundred.) While similar, lemmas are still distinctively different from Item labels. For Item labels users are expected to enter as many as they can, while for lemmas users will only enter multiple lemmas if the Lexeme requires it. Example: The American "color" and British "colour" are supposed to be modeled as lemmas on a single Lexeme. A best-case approximation are two lemmas per Lexeme,

* In contract to Item labels, the lemma of a Lexeme is (by definition) as are (mostly, but not exclusively) single words only.
* One of the longest words in an English dictionary is "Supercalifragilisticexpialidocious" (34 characters). Some other candidates for a longest word in other languages are about 70 characters long, see http://mentalfloss.com/article/50611/longest-word-in-the-world.
...
I talked to PM (@Lydia_Pintscher) and we established the limit should **not** be 255 bytes, but 768.
